	i just installed red hat linux 6.0 on my system ...

now i was trying to configure the caching-only dns.
( as it takes quite long to get the prompt when i telnet from other machine
on the network )

for that i edited the /etc/named.conf file and added

zone "5.168.192.in-addr.arpa" {
type master;
file "named.192.168.5";
};

then i created the file /var/named/named.192.168.5
 and put in the related hostname and domain name etc ..

finally i restarted the named : /etc/rc.d/init.d/named restart

still when i telnet 192.168.5.3 from my windows machine on the network, it
takes over 60 secounds to show the prompy
